William E “Bill” Baer, Kenny Baer, and Patrick Maffett of Baer Wealth Management, LLC have spent a combined over 40 years in the financial services business. The staff of Baer Wealth Management follow a conservative investing model which adheres to the philosophy that it is not what you make, but what you keep that matters.
“Rule Number 1: Don’t lose the money! Rule Number 2: Don’t forget rule Number 1!”
Kenny Baer has been with Baer Wealth Management since his graduation from Elon University in 2002. Kenny is born and raised in Atlanta and prides himself in being involved with the local community. Kenny is a volunteer baseball coach at Northside Youth Organization (NYO); and in the summer of 2010 his 10 year old travel team won the State Championship Tournament held in Ringgold, GA.
Kenny Baer is a certified teacher in the ABC method of conservative investing and has spoken at conferences throughout the United States espousing the benefits of such an approach. Kenny has also been published in Investment Advisor Magazine speaking to the benefits of an Open Architecture practice, currently co-host the radio show “The Money Gurus” with Patrick Maffett and previously co-hosted “The Baer Facts” with his father Bill. Kenny Baer has been interviewed on Atlanta Business Daily and created a Money Minute that aired daily on AM stations throughout Atlanta. Kenny is also a new father and proud parent of Sunny Elizabeth Baer, born December 18th, 2011.
Patrick K. Maffett joined Baer Wealth Management in 2011. He is currently a candidate for his Chartered Financial Analyst (CFA) designation. Patrick graduated from the Georgia Institute of Technology with a degree in Management/Finance. He is a native of Roswell, Georgia and currently resides in Buckhead. He is an avid student of finance and economics. His professional focus is on investment analysis and portfolio management. Patrick mostly subscribes to a value investing philosophy and, as such, is a follower of some of the world’s most successful value investors, such as Warren Buffett and Benjamin Graham. In his spare time, Patrick enjoys tennis, fly fishing, rock climbing, and hunting.
